Why Get ACLS Certified?

ACLS training is intended to help medical workers go beyond basic life support abilities and get a more in-depth understanding of advanced life support. It also teaches patients how to preserve neurological function during cardiac-related events like heart attacks or strokes, as well as basic medication treatment and effective team dynamics to enhance patient outcomes.

Pre-requisites for the ACLS course

The following are course prerequisites for obtaining your ACLS certification:

• Have a current American Heart Association BLS for Healthcare Providers CPR card

• Have a basic understanding of rhythm reading

• Have a basic understanding of cardiac pharmacology

• Have the most recent American Heart Association ACLS book

ACLS Certification Courses Available Online

If you work in healthcare, you know how busy life can be, and fitting ACLS training into your schedule may be challenging. Fortunately, modern technologies have made it possible to complete your training course online. An online ACLS course is ideal for busy people since it allows them to complete 80% of the course online at their leisure while the remaining 20% is hands-on and skills-based. This allows the student to complete the online portion at any time and from any location.
